Understanding Lean Six Sigma Healthcare Certification And Its Importance

Lean Six Sigma Healthcare Certification is a valuable professional qualification designed to improve healthcare operations by reducing waste, increasing efficiency, and enhancing patient care quality. This certification combines Lean principles focused on eliminating unnecessary processes with Six Sigma methodologies that aim to reduce errors and variations. Healthcare professionals who gain this certification learn how to identify operational challenges, streamline workflows, and create better systems that support both medical teams and patients. With the growing demand for efficient healthcare services, Lean Six Sigma skills have become highly beneficial for managers, administrators, nurses, and other healthcare professionals.

How Lean Six Sigma Improves Healthcare Quality Management

Quality management is a critical part of modern healthcare, and Lean Six Sigma provides a structured approach for continuous improvement. The certification teaches methods such as DMAIC (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ve, and Control), which helps healthcare teams identify problems and develop effective solutions. By applying these techniques, organizations can minimize medical errors, improve safety procedures, and enhance overall service quality. Healthcare providers with Lean Six Sigma expertise can support a culture of improvement where employees work together to create safer and more reliable healthcare environments.

Choosing The Right Lean Six Sigma Healthcare Certification Program

Selecting the right Lean Six Sigma Healthcare Certification program is important for achieving professional growth and practical knowledge. A good program should provide healthcare-focused examples, experienced instructors, and training on real-world improvement projects. Learners should consider certification levels such as Yellow Belt, Green Belt, or Black Belt based on their career goals and experience.
